3. The human body excretes nitrogen in the form of urea, NH2CONH2. The key biochemical step in urea formation is the reaction of water with arginine to produce urea and ornithine:


 (a) What is the mass percent of nitrogen in urea , arginine, and ornithine? 

(b) How many grams of nitrogen can be excreted as urea when 143.2 g of ornithine is produced?
